Thomas "Irish" Barry

December 8, 1930 ~ October 20, 2014
Thomas "Irish" Barry age 83, of Painesville, passed away peacefully surrounded by his wife and children on October 20, 2014. He was born December 8th, 1930 in Geneva, Ohio to Thomas and Winifred (Robinette) Barry. He and his wife, Janet (Johnson), were married for 61 years. They were high school sweethearts, best friends and classmates at Madison High School graduating in 1949. He was a devoted Catholic all his life and a parishioner of St. Mary's Catholic Church in Painesville for many years. Tom spent 2 years serving his country in the Army stationed at Camp Jima in Japan. He was an Industrial Arts teacher at Eastlake and Willowick Jr. High School for 27 years. Tom was also a member of the Sheet Metal Workers Union Local #65 for 50 years. Tom was a devoted husband, father and grandfather to his 8 children, 16 grandchildren and 7 great grandchildren. "Papa Tom" was always present at the sporting events of his grandchildren, being their biggest fan, toughest coach and greatest motivator. Tom cherished his childhood hometown of Madison and loved to reminisce and tell stories of the good old days to whoever wanted to hear them. He also enjoyed travelling with family and friends, even making the back to the family homestead in Ireland with his children. He was a thoughtful and generous man always there for his family and friends. Many have relied on him for his kindness and warm sense of humor.
